Vehicle registration fees are deductible as personal property taxes
only
if your state assesses the fees based on the value of the vehicle.
Colorado does charge a tax based on the vehicle's value. This
information is found on your vehicle registration bill.
According
to the Colorado Department of Revenue (Division of Motor Vehicle)
website, ownership tax is in lieu of personal property tax.
